Between 1995 and 2010, Magic Keys proliferated. Remember the infamous "FCKGW-RHQQ2..." key for Windows XP? That wasn't a crack; it was a leaked Volume License Key (VLK) from Microsoft. Because Microsoft allowed a single key to activate thousands of corporate PCs, that key acted as a Magic Key for the entire consumer world.
